veilings

[美國]/[ˈveɪlɪŋz]/
[英國]/[ˈveɪlɪŋz]/

中文釋義

n. 掩蓋的行為;覆蓋物;尤其是新娘的頭巾。
v. 覆蓋或隱藏。

例句

the dense fog was a series of veilings over the mountain peaks.

濃霧是山巒上一層層的遮蔽。

the artist used subtle veilings of color to create a dreamlike effect.

藝術家運用色彩的細緻遮蔽,創造出夢幻般的效果。

the politician's answers were full of veilings and evasions.

政治人物的回應充滿了隱瞞與閃避。

the historical record contains many veilings of the truth about the event.

這段歷史記錄中包含許多關於事件真相的隱瞞。

the bride's veilings added an air of mystery to her appearance.

新娘的頭紗為她的外貌增添了一絲神秘感。

the company's veilings of its financial problems were ultimately unsuccessful.

該公司對財務問題的隱瞞最終未能成功。

the report exposed the veilings surrounding the project's failures.

這份報告揭露出圍繞專案失敗的隱瞞。

the author employed veilings of symbolism throughout the novel.

作者在整部小說中運用符號的隱晦手法。

the security measures included veilings of cameras and sensors.

安全措施包括對攝影機和感應器的遮蔽。

the government's veilings of information fueled public suspicion.

政府對資訊的隱瞞加劇了公眾的懷疑。

the software's veilings made it difficult to understand its functionality.

該軟體的隱瞞使得理解其功能變得困難。
